Description

Composition: 100% Chardonnay - Terroir Chouilly Grand Cru, 67% 2021 vintage and 33% reserve wines (started in 1982 by Jacques Vazart). 4.5g sugar. Disgorged: June 2024.

Aromas: This Blanc de Blancs Champagne displays a pale yellow color with green reflections, fine and delicate bubbles that convey a fresh and airy impression. Fine aromas of citrus fruits, gentle chalk, iodine, grapefruit, and acacia lend floral notes and a hint of minerality to this delicate and fruity Champagne.

Recommendation: An enjoyable Champagne perfect as an aperitif, also harmonizes perfectly with oysters, grapefruit carpaccio, pan-seared scallops, cod loin in a delicate saffron butter sauce, etc.

Awards: 91/100 Wine Spectator

Gault&Millau 92/100

"Magnifiques bulles frétillantes, crépitantes, fines, sans exubérance. Cette cuvée se livre sans fards ni paillettes, avec une bouche sans artifice : c’est d’une beauté sans excès. Le vin nous caresse et nous charme, mais avec discrétion et élégance. À découvrir sans plus attendre."

Eng: "Beautiful quivering, crackling bubbles, fine, without exuberance. This cuvée reveals itself without fuss or glitter, with an artless palate: it is a beauty without excess. The wine caresses and charms us, but with discretion and elegance. Discover it without further delay."


Note on possible allergens: contains alcohol, sulfites, and residual sugar

Champagne should be stored in a cool, dark place, ideally at a constant temperature between 7-10°C. The bottles should be stored horizontally to keep the cork moist. Avoid direct sunlight and strong temperature fluctuations. Well-stored champagnes can age and gain complexity over many years.

Champagne should be served in flutes or tulip glasses to best preserve its aroma. Chill the bottle for at least 3 hours in the refrigerator or 20 minutes in an ice bucket to 6-8°C. Open the bottle carefully by removing the wire and slowly twisting out the cork. Serve immediately to enjoy its freshness and effervescence.
